    Default Egypt FM to Israel: Don't Attack Gaza

    Egypt on Thursday warned Israel against taking extensive defense activities in Gaza in response to recent rocket attacks by Gaza Arab terrorists. Egypt's new foreign minister, Nabil Arabi, said that such an attack “will only increase the tension” in the region. In a statement, he said that an Israeli attack “will not serve the interests of any party, and will further damage the peace process.”

    Arabi also slammed the PA terror groups, whom he said were giving Israel and “opportunity to attack them” by continuing their rocket fire on Israel. He added that Egypt opposed all violence and damage to citizens, whomever they may be.
